KARLSKRONA (Sweden)
The city was founded in 1680 on the initiative of Karl XI to protect the fleet and demonstrate the power of Sweden. Beautifully located, the city spreads on 33 islands of Blekinge archipelago on the south-eastern edge of the Scandinavian Peninsula. It is a typical seaside city with a modern small shipping port situated almost in the centre of the city. Recognized as a naval history treasure, Karlskrona was included in the UNESCO World Heritage List in 1998. The city has about 60 700 inhabitants. Visitors to Karlskrona may admire buildings erected in 16th-17th century - the period when Sweden was a superpower. Among the monuments of naval history one can visit 300-meter long rope-making shed, Kungsholm fort as well as Drottningskär citadel.
The city is a fast growing IT and telecommunication centre. Telecom City - a network of about 100 IT companies operates in Karlskrona. In 2001 the city was distinguished as the fastest developing Swedish city.
The twinning agreement was signed on 09th November 1990. It covers the cooperation within environmental protection, transport, industrial issues, education, culture, sport and tourism.
The effects of the cooperation:
- gift from the Arbetsmarknadsinstitutet in Karlskrona to the Cerebral Palsy Victims Help Association: computer set and Xerox
- Municipal Welfare Centre (MOPS) in Gdynia came into contact with Karlskrona within the programme SALIDA in May 1995. The purpose of the programme was exchange of the experiences and methods applied to solving social problems such as alcoholism and drug addiction. The programme made it possible for the employees of MOPS to get acquainted with the conditions and methods of work of the social welfare in Sweden. Within this project MOPS hosted Swedish social workers in its centres.
- TEM/TER project -Trans European Motorway/Trans European Railway - it is a transit motorway connecting northern and southern Europe, from Gdynia/ Gdańsk to Athens/Ankara and in the north from Karlskrona to Oslo (TEM Scandinavia). The ferry connection Gdynia- Karlskrona , which is the result of the cooperation between the two cities, is an important element of the planned motorway. In Poland the TEM Amber Motorway Cities Association was established (the declaration of the Association was signed by 6 Polish cities) to coordinate the works connected with building of the motorway on the Polish stretch. Gdynia was the founder of the Association. Karlskrona is the leader of the TEM Scandinavia Cities Association in Sweden, the declaration of which was signed by 11 Scandinavian cities. Both associations engage in the work to create a lobby for the realization of TEM/TER project.

- Study visit of representatives of Swedish police from Karlskrona to Gdynia. The guests took part in the meeting in the Police Headquarters in Gdynia (KMP). In the course of this meeting there was presented the organizational structure of Police Headquarters in Gdynia, the main rules of commanding prevention forces. There were also discussed issues referring to foreigners detained on Polish territory and there were presented rules of functioning of the criminal department of the Police Headquarters in Gdynia. There were also presented problems connected with the fight against drug crimes and informational policy adopted by the police station in Gdynia. The meeting had as its aim to define common problems which Polish and Swedish policemen face and create an experience exchange programme. The Polish side was represented by Police Chief and the head of the Police Headquarters in Gdynia. The guests had the opportunity to see the police station in Gdynia Chylonia and receive detailed information about the work of the station. In the City Hall of Gdynia there was held a meeting of the representatives of Swedish police and the local authorities of Gdynia, representatives of the Safety Commission and the Chief of Pomorskie Province Police - Mr. Stanisław Białas. As a result of the talks the guests agreed the cooperation programme and the programme of mutual training visits with each other- November 1999
- Return visit of police from Gdynia to Karlskrona in order to get acquainted with Swedish methods of fighting against crime and drug addiction. In the course of the visit a proposal had been put forward to start a closer cooperation between the policemen from Gdynia and from Karlskrona on the eradication of drugs. The purpose of the cooperation was to create liaison officers. Such cooperation would be very useful especially in the case of exchange of information about the already existing and the newly introduced intoxicating stuff in both cities- March 2000
